
Bio - Katia Saure
Ms. Katia Saure was born and raised in Ponce, Puerto Rico. She has been working at Washburn School for three years after completing her bachelor's in Elementary Education (K- 6) with a concentration in English at the Pontifical Catholic University of Puerto Rico, Ponce Campus, in December 2018. Additionally, she completed courses in history and visual arts, things she is also passionate about. She is an active member of Puerto Rico TESOL, the organization that inspired her to become an educator. As a teacher who loves reading, she hopes to inspire her students to become avid readers through their different interests. In her free time, she enjoys reading, spending time with her pets, and painting in acrylic.
